Course Content
Movement system, Respiratory system, Circulatory system, Digestive system, Urogenital system, Endocrine system, Nervous system, Sensory organs
Objectives of the Course
In Physiology course; the basic structure of the body and the physiological characteristics of the structures and organs that make up the systems.

Weekly Detailed Course Contents
| Week | Topics |
|---|---|
| 1 | Introduction to Physiology |
| 2 | Blood physiology |
| 3 | Immune system physiology |
| 4 | Kas sistemi fizyolojisi |
| 5 | Cardiac physiology |
| 6 | Respiratory system physiology |
| 7 | Circulatory system physiology |
| 8 | Physiology of the digestive system |
| 9 | Physiology of the excretory system |
| 10 | Reproductive system (Female) - Reproductive system (Male) - Endocrine system physiology |
| 11 | Physiology of the nervous system |
| 12 | Sensory physiology - Taste, Smell, and Touch |
| 13 | Sensory physiology - Vision |
| 14 | Sensory physiology - Hearing |
